Border Patrol agents on Wednesday opened a gate that had previously been locked by members of the Texas National Guard, in order to allow a number of illegal immigrants deeper into the United States.
Fox News witnessed members of the guard close and lock the gate, which is situated on private property and had previously been open, to deny entry to migrants who had crossed illegally and were expecting to be allowed into the U.S.
The illegal immigrants were then seen standing outside the gate waiting to be allowed in, with the Texas National Guard watching on.
A short time later, Border Patrol agents appeared with a key and opened the door, allowing the migrants to get through and be processed into the U.S. immigration system.
The incident demonstrates the stark contrast in approach between Texas authorities and Customs and Border Protection (CBP).
Under Gov. Greg Abbott, Texas has surged law enforcement to the border under Operation Lone Star.
